We took our four adult kids (20 to 29) to this spot for a week, and while we hoped to enjoy ourselves we never expected to have one of the best family vacations we've ever had. We have done cruises, we have stayed at all inclusive resorts, and we do enjoy them. But the trouble vacationing with older kids in a resort or on a cruise is that as soon as you arrive they go their way and you go yours, and you never see each other until the plane ride home. But this is a real home, in a real neighborhood, and it made all the difference. We loved the pool, loved lounging around the house, loved swimming in the ocean out back, and the young adults ADORED the Tiki Beach each and every night until it closed. We cooked in or BBQed on the deck almost every night, with lots of laughs (and photos. Then each evening, the kids took off for the nightlife just 10 minutes away on 7 mile beach while we sipped wine and watched the sun setting with the occasional local fisherman silhouetted on the distant jetty. We ate out at Alfresco's one night, and enjoyed the food and views. We also took a day trip to the other side of the island, to Rum Point, and spent the day there. Great fun and killer Blue Iguanas (curacao and rum). We went to the national park just up the road (literally) and met some of the park staff who told us about their conservation efforts and helped us identify some birds and lizards. We also did some traditional stuff, like the catamaran trip to stingray city, which should definitely not be missed, and a snorkel on the big reef. We tried to snorkel off the nearby beaches nearer to the wall, but to be honest, the snorkeling outside of our door, especially toward the jetty and into the old dock there, was great, and better than anywhere nearby. The kids did a sunset cruise, and they went horseback riding with Honeysuckle Stables, a five minute walk up the road. (He lets you take the horses on the beach, and into the water.) The photos, even the video, for CBE do not do it justice. We all agreed. The premises is clean, nicely decorated, and the layout is great for a group. Housekeeping came in once during the week to freshen up, which was nice. The owner called mid-week to check in, a terrific touch. Sometimes “Fred” the iguana suns himself on the TV antenna.. but hey.. it’s the islands! We have already recommended this property to friends.
